Sally R Delgado 1951 - 2008

Sally R Delgado was born on January 16, 1951, and died at age 57 years old on June 30, 2008. Sally Delgado was buried at Ft. Logan National Cemetery Section 46 Site 552 4400 West Kenyon Avenue, in Denver, Co. Family, friend, or fan, this family history biography is for you to remember Sally R Delgado.

In 1951, in the year that Sally R Delgado was born, on June 25th, CBS began broadcasting in color. There were well over 10 million televisions by that time. The first show in color was a musical variety special titled "Premiere". Hardly anyone had a color TV that could see the show.

In 1968, when she was 17 years old, on January 31st, the North Vietnamese launched the Tet Offensive, a turning point in the Vietnam War. 70,000 North Vietnamese and Viet Cong forces swarmed into South Vietnam. The South Vietnamese and US troops held off the offensive but it was such fierce fighting that the U.S. public began to turn against the war.
